abstract
We show that two natural cycle classes on the moduli space of compact type stable maps to a varying elliptic curve agree. The first is the virtual fundamental class from Gromov-Witten theory, and the second is the Torelli pullback of the special cycle on A_g of principally polarized abelian varieties admitting an elliptic isogeny factor.
